
在现代企业和个人通信中,邮箱服务器的配置与优化是保障信息传递畅通、安全、高效的关键环节。合理而严谨的配置不仅能提升邮件的送达率,还能防止废品邮件、钓鱼攻击等安全威胁。本文将详细解析邮箱服务器的填写步骤,从基础设置到高级优化策略,为用户提供全面、实用的指导,以确保邮箱系统的稳定性和安全性。
一、邮箱服务器基础配置
在搭建或配置邮箱服务器的初期,首要任务是确保基本功能的正常运作。这包括服务器的硬件选择、操作系统的安装与设置、基础网络配置等。这里将逐步引导你完成基础配置流程。
1. 选择合适的硬件与操作系统
对于企业级邮箱服务器,建议选择性能稳定、扩展性强的硬件设备,包括高品质的CPU、足够的内存(建议8GB及以上)、高速存储(SSD优先)。操作系统方面,Linux(如Ubuntu Server、CentOS、Debian)因其开源、稳定、安全性高而成为首选。而对于小规模或个人使用,Windows Server也是一种方案,但需要考虑授权成本及维护能力。
2. 安装与基本配置
在安装操作系统后,应执行以下基础配置:
- 禁用不必要的服务,减小攻击面。
- 设置静态IP地址,确保服务器的网络可达性。
- 配置防火墙,允许SMTP(端口25)、SMTP SSL(端口465或587)、IMAP(端口143或993)、POP3(端口110或995)等必要端口,同时关闭所有未使用的端口。
- 定期更新系统,打上最新的安全补丁。
二、配置邮件服务软件
常用的邮件服务器软件包括Postfix、Exim、Microsoft Exchange、MailEnable等。本文以Open Source的Postfix为例,详细介绍配置步骤,当然,其他软件的配置步骤类似。
1. 安装Postfix
在Ubuntu/Debian系统上,可通过以下命令安装:
sudo apt updatesudo apt install postfix
在安装过程中,系统会提示你选择配置类型,通常选择“Internet Site”,然后输入你的域名(如example.com)。
2. 配置基本参数
配置文件主要位于`/etc/postfix/main.cf`,其中包含了核心参数。建议你逐项配置或确认以下内容:
-
myhostname
:服务器的完整域名(如mail.example.com) -
mydomain
:域名(例:example.com) -
myorigin
:邮件发出域(一般设置为$mydomain) -
inet_interfaces
:监听接口(一般设置为all或localhost) -
mydestination
:邮件目的地(应包括$myhostname, localhost, localhost.$mydomain) -
relayhost
:转发SMTP服务器(如果使用第三方SMTP服务)
3. 配置域名与MX记录
确保你的域名解析设置正确,必须设置对应的A记录(指向邮件服务器IP)和MX记录(指向邮件服务器域名)。例如:
- A记录:mail.example.com → 192.168.X.X
- MX记录:优先级10 → mail.example.com
这样,其他邮件服务器才能正确找到你的邮箱服务器。
三、安全配置的基础措施
在基本配置完成后,需进一步加强邮箱服务器的安全性,防止滥用和攻击。这包括SMTP认证、TLS加密、反废品邮件、反钓鱼等策略。
1. 配置TLS加密
SSL/TLS加密保障邮件在传输中的机密性。获取有效的SSL证书(可以使用Let’s Encrypt免费证书),配置Postfix支持STARTTLS:
sudo certbot certonly --standalone -d mail.example.com
然后在`main.cf`中加入:
smtpd_tls_cert_file=/path/to/fullchain.pemsmtpd_tls_key_file=/path/to/privkey.pemsmtpd_use_tls=yessmtpd_tls_auth_only=yes
2. SMTP认证(SMTP AUTH)
启用SMTP认证,要求发件人登录后才能发送邮件,有效防止滥发:
smtpd_sasl_auth_enable = yessmtpd_sasl_type = cyrussmtpd_sasl_path = smtpd
配置好后,建议强制SSL/TLS传输认证,具体细节需根据使用的SMTP认证方案调整。
3. 反废品邮件与反钓鱼策略
使用Postfix自带的策略或集成第三方工具(如SpamAssassin、ClamAV)进行废品邮件过滤和病毒扫描。还可以启用DNSBL(DNS黑名单)以及RBL(Realtime Blackhole List)策略,阻止已知恶意IP的连接请求。
示例配置DNSBL:
reject_rbl_client zen.spamhaus.orgreject_rbl_client bl.spameatingmonkey.net
四、高级优化与性能调优
基础配置完成后,若需支持大量用户和高并发访问,必须进行性能优化。这涉及硬件调优、软件参数调整,以及监控体系建立。
1. 硬件优化
增加内存和CPU资源,确保硬盘I/O性能达到要求。使用SSD可以明显降低存取延时。对于大规模环境,负载均衡、多服务器集群更是必要方案。
2. 软件调优
调整Postfix参数以提升性能,例如:
- 调整邮件队列大小
- 设置合理的超时与重试机制
- 启用fast queue worker,减少队列处理时间
3. 防止滥用与滥发
通过配置速率限制(rate limiting)、SMTP会话限制、连接数限制等措施减轻服务器负载,防止被用作发废品邮件的工具。
4. 监控与日志分析
定期查看邮件日志(如`/var/log/mail.log`),分析发信/收信情况,识别异常行为。结合监控工具(如Zabbix、Nagios)持续追踪系统性能和安全指标。
五、维护与持续优化建议
邮箱服务器并非“一次配置,永不调整”的系统。应建立完善的维护机制:
- 定期更新软件和安全补丁
- 监控服务器硬件状态和网络流量
- 及时清理邮件队列,处理死信和异常邮件
- 备份配置文件和关键数据,防止灾难恢复
- 加强用户培训,避免因操作不当引发安全漏洞
六、总结
邮箱服务器的配置是一个复杂且持续的过程,涉及基础硬件选择、系统安装、自定义软件配置、安全强化、性能优化等多个环节。只有在每个环节都精心设计、不断调整,才能建立一套稳定、安全、高效的邮箱体系。以下总结几点经验:
- 始终将安全放在第一位,从基础配置到高级策略都要考虑到潜在威胁。
- 合理规划域名和DNS设置,确保邮件的可达性。
- 启用加密和认证措施,防止数据泄露与滥用。
- 结合监控工具,实时掌握系统动态,快速响应异常。
- 持续学习与积累经验,跟踪最新的邮件安全和优化技术。
通过上述详尽的步骤和建议,相信你能够构建一套符合实际需求的高效、安全的邮箱服务器,为个人或企业通讯保驾护航。邮件系统的维护虽然复杂,但只要采取科学的方法,持之以恒,必能实现长期稳定的运行目标。









